Anna Olehivna Muzychuk (Ukrainian: Анн́а Оле́гівна Музичу́к; Slovene: Ana Muzičuk; born 28 February 1990) is a Ukrainian chess player who holds the title of Grandmaster (GM). She is the fourth woman in chess history to attain a FIDE rating of at least 2600. She has been ranked as high as No. 197 in the … See more Anna Muzychuk was born on 28 February 1990 in Lviv to Nataliya and Oleh Muzychuk. She grew up with her sister Mariya, who is two years younger, in the nearby smaller city of Stryi.
